San Mehat goes to work for VA Research
The little bird flitted in and told me that San Mehat has left Corel to go work for VA Research. One of his cool projects is getting Linux into the bios. Man, VA seems to be collecting all the fun people.
I guess the 2600 meetings in Ottawa will never be the same! :-( San was a major resource of knowledge...and a decent person too! Not that it matters to me, since I now live at "the center of universe", and that ain't Ottawa, thank god!
I think DOSEmu and perhaps some power management stuff may use the BIOS.
One of the bores of having a laptop is that since
you shut it down alot more than a desktop you have
to wait for it to boot up everytime. Linux in
BIOS would let me have an instant-on Linux laptop?
anyone know what job he got?
Dec/Compaq Alpha - the intel of Linux
you gotta figure if we are running all Linux software who needs the x8086 world anymore?
What's wrong with Intel being the Intel of Linux?
Intel is actually very Linux-friendly; they made
equity investments in Red Hat and are supporting
VA in their port of Linux to Merced.
The loading of the kernel from disk is _not_ what takes the time. You still have to boot the kernel and start everything up. You'd save perhaps a few seconds total unless you tried something absurd like restoring a complete running image from FLASH. Don't forget to put all those I/O devices back into the same state they were!
Also, on the PC the BIOS is 8Bit and really slow in comparison to RAM, so your not going to run the kernel in place like we do for uClinux running in FLASH. BTW, if you do try to run the kernel XIP from FLASH (or any read only memory for that matter) be aware that stock Linux 2.0 (I don't know about 2.2) has some structures which are written to in the text segment... Anyway, if you're going to copy the kernel to RAM from FLASH anyway, I wonder what the advantage is. Embedded systems and x86 sub notebooks without disks perhaps?
D. Jeff Dionne
Geeze....Sam ain't dead. And who knows, maybe :)
he will telecommute
It would be really sweet if he could shoehorn in
an assembler and debugger as well.
i'm wondering why winzozz notebook can "suspend" to disk their session and my linux no!
i believe would be an interesting option to save to disk all the RAM of my linux, and later resume all the sessions more quickly..
is there any project ongoing?
ciao
andrea venturi
VA---the Compaq of Linux
I think people just can't stand to let something right happen. They almost have a Linux defeatists attitude, and still want to peddle elitist dogma around...
VA Research is based in Mountain View California (why the heck is it called VA Research?
Anyone know?)
[VA]Its the initials of the 2 founders (I think one is gone, but the other is now the CEO)
Huh? I thought it was for Value Added Research.. Gues not.
JamesB (I should realy register an Accout)
Sheesh.. my name's SaN :)
and Russ, you can buy me lunch / dinner at
Linux Expo..
-san
(its San here... dont have stable email yet so /. account)
i cant get a
Putting linux into the BIOS is more or less a way
of allowing infinite end-user/power-user boot
flexibility and recovery... since I have a nasty
headache at the moment i wont elaberate too much... I'm putting together a white paper on it
which at some point in the future i'll post somewhere....
-san
(soon to be sanm@varesearch.com)
(san here again)
:)
well.. in truth.. *yes* I did write NeTTrom
sheesh.. thought the name of it would be enough
-san (NeTTwerk)
derek!
What a strange place to be having a reunion
from the old days.
Tell san I said hi. Maybe I'll make my way
down there too...everyone else seems to.
Steve
VA Research is based in Mountain View California (why the heck is it called VA Research? Anyone know?)
Some tech firms actually headquartered in Virginia: AOL, Circuit City...umm maybe someone can come up with some better examples :).
I would suspect two things:
1) VA may be thinking of coming out with a competitor to the Cobalt Qube. Think Netwinder except perhaps Intel-powered (considering VA's connections with Intel).
2) VA may be thinking of coming out with their own motherboards for (choose one) laptop, high-end server, or diskless workstation, and needs someone expert in BIOS issues to make the BIOS part work.
Please note that I have no real idea what VA is up to, for obvious reasons (I don't work for them!). Just that those would be why *I* would want to hire him, if I had the R&D budget to do so.
-- Eric
Send mail here if you want to reach me.
Looks like they contracted one instead. See the press releases earlier about VA outsourcing the manufacture of most of their systems.
-- Eric
Send mail here if you want to reach me.
Posted by tahmed:
:)
OH MY GOD... My friend Kevin from CISCO who reads this place (he's at CISCO in Ottawa) told me about this discussion. What a small world. San's like one of my best friends, he's staying with me, moved here on Wednesday. Right now he's looking for a "Melrose Place" like pad and starts work on Monday (they hooked him up with a crazy ass computer, quad proc Xeon).
For you people who don't know.. Ottawa is Canada's
capital city.. Not Toronto!! Like anyone cares
Chris
Evangelist, VA.
--
Grant Chair, Linux Int.
VP, SVLUG
Co-Editor, Open Sources
Open Source Program Manager, Google, Inc.
"Oh C'mon", to the VA==compaq comment. Sorry if you misunderstood. And I assure you that I am a "real" Linux user.
I don't even own a mac!
It's funny that you thought I was a mac person though.
Chris DiBona VA Research.
Grant Chair, Linux International
--
Grant Chair, Linux Int.
VP, SVLUG
Co-Editor, Open Sources
Open Source Program Manager, Google, Inc.
Chris
--
Grant Chair, Linux Int.
VP, SVLUG
Co-Editor, Open Sources
Open Source Program Manager, Google, Inc.
Chris
--
Grant Chair, Linux Int.
VP, SVLUG
Co-Editor, Open Sources
Open Source Program Manager, Google, Inc.
Chris
--
Grant Chair, Linux Int.
VP, SVLUG
Co-Editor, Open Sources
Open Source Program Manager, Google, Inc.
V and A were the initials of the two founders. One I have forgotten, but the A was for Larry Augustin.
--
--
I noticed
It's getting about time to leave everywhere
And it has been done in the netwinder, and I wouldn't be surprised if San did it :-)
:-)
You have the nettrom+rescue image, which boots a full linux system from the EEPROM. Ok, full is a bit too much, but it is enough to do a full reinstall of the OS over a network without having to set NFS root.
I must confess I have never used it, because I had a tftp/kernel NFS/root setup already configured, but anyway, it still sounds really cool.
The netwinder can boot almost out of a used chewing gum
How about, "Your momma, the Monica Lewinsky of Linux"?
Beer recipe: free! #Source
Cold pints: $2 #Product
The Netwinder has a 1M flash memory containing a Linux kernel and an intelligent boot-loader that lets you choose a kernel and root device to boot from (this can be from a local disk or over the network). While LILO can only find a kernel by knowing its physical location on a disk, the Netwinder boot manager mounts a partition and looks for the kernel by name. There's a lot of other cool things that can be done with decent firmware; I'd be glad to see yet another bit of legacy x86 baggage go on the scrap heap.
Who is San Mehat? Sorry, but I have never heard this name before...
Gabor Kuti is working on a portable suspend-to-disk feature. Homepage a href="http://falcon.sch.bme.hu/~seasons/linux/swsu sp.html ">here.
This brings up an interesting point: Is there a way to compile a ROMable kernel? I mean, one that can execute directly from ROM, rather than loading it into RAM? I know there are writable strings and, of course, allocated RAM, but one could move them into RAMspace.
Come to think of it, you'd have to:
Whew! That's gonna be REEEEAL easy.
Me, I'd like to see a kernel that uses kmodd to reduce boot-up time by delaying device init until the device is needed. We should see initrd bootups in the 1-sec range.
If I were working for either VA or Red Hat, I'd find these comparisons really quite insulting.
Try
UUNet
MCI/WorldCom
RoadRunner (cable modem)
PSINet
and a world of Beltway Bandits ( Governement Leeche^H^H^H^H^H Contractors, can you say SAIC?)
-- I am not a fanatic, I am a true believer.
Zaphod! San, did you name that after Zaphod Beeblebrox!?! Other than the novel, Zaphod's is
a bar here in Ottawa that I used to and I believe San still frequents.
San! We still didn't get together for that lunch! shoot me an email if you see this!
-- I speak only for myself.
This can only be a good thing, I would like to have better firmware tools, like on my sparcs where I can run scsi-probe and other useful things, or the hinv on the SGI systems. The PC bios has always seemed less full-featured then other unix workstations.
Sure, the more they resemble Sun, SGI, and the other commercial Unix vendors. Also, the more they resemble most large PC vendors.
But changing the BIOS won't necessarily mean you lose standard hardware, just that you have a custom bios in flash. And that's easy to replace.
You can set your laptop to go into suspend mode. So you stop what you are doing, suspend, and later turn it on right back to where you were...
Cheers,
Ben Tilly
My usual seat in the cluetrain is at A HREF="http://pub4.ezboard.com/biwethey.ht
What exactly does "getting linux into the bios"
mean? Hardware compatability factors? Booting
options to do away with lilo, etc? Do we even
*use* the PC BIOS after booting? (I thought we
did not...)
-fb Everything not expressly forbidden is now mandatory.
That would kick serious butt. I (and many others I know) would probably buy those by the six-pack.
Fuck Slashdot
Delivering correctly configured computers on time (a noted VA weakness) is probably a bigger issue to address.
Once Dell starts shipping linux, VA is going to be in big trouble unless they become more fascist about delivering the right product on time.
San was one of Corel Computer Corporation's engineers. I've met him a couple times at Linux Expo's. He's a really cool guy. He was responsible for a lot of work with the Netwinder, firmware and I believe hardware too. It seems to me that since CCC was bought by Canadian Hardware Solutions the Netwinder has sort of stagnated. After all I was excitedly awaiting the unvailing of the Zaphod which was San's baby at the Atlanta Linux Show Case and that never became a product.
The Zaphod was to be a 10 NW Beowulf system in its own case. Would have made a hell of a good ERP hardware platform with the numeric processing and network throughput. The redundancy it would have offered would have been grand too. Never really happened though.
I'll be flying my NW at half mast today.
But I'm sure San will be happy at VA.
As in BIOS??
A firmware Linux?
-- What you do today will cost you a day of your life.
I can see it now:
Instant-on Linux boxes, no more looking at clouds or little dots walking on the screen.
FlashEEPROM OS that finishes the comparison test before the 'other' OS is even done booting.
Mmmm - warm fuzzies all over.
-- What you do today will cost you a day of your life.
Woo-hoo!
-- What you do today will cost you a day of your life.
That's the best spanking I've seen since I last visited San Francisco.
Well done, mr Natural.
********* sig: If you don't like the law, get filthy stinking rich, and buy a better one.
Well, VA is backed, in part, by Intel. Intel motherboards ave 4 megabit flash memory for the firmware.
That is certainly enough room for a decent boot loader, some diagnostics and some decent remote boot firmware. Not quite enough for a compressed kernel, I don't think, but an 8 megabit flash might be.
If I'm not mistaken I saw an alpha that had MILO flashed into the bios at the linux general store. Not for sale. Someone had just done it.
"Fighting the underpants gnomes since 1998!" "Bruce Schneier knows the state of schroedinger's cat"
Actually, Apple is going the opposite way. The newer machines have a smaller boot rom and load
a file containing all of the stuff that used to be in the rom. Maybe there's a convergence here... the traditional PC BIOS is too brain-dead, and the Mac had too much stuff (GUI code) in the ROM.
It makes me happy that they can get the biggest shots to work for them. More power to 'em.
This is one of the ugliest areas of PC architecture. One reason doing this in a generic way is non-trivial is that each laptop mfr. does it differently. With APM and ACPI (not in Linux yet, so far as I know) there are fianlly decent hooks into suspend-to-ram, but suspend-to-disk is still done in many different ways: some use regular fils in the FS, some use dedicated partitions, some can use a combination (Dell), and many also require a special program (never documented) to prepare the S2D target area. Combine this with the fact that different BIOSes handle this differently (although APM/ACPI helps a lot) and you understand why we have problems with this.
Oh, and then there's the point that BIOS functionality is pretty much controlled by MS now, at least for the big OEMs, since a decent MS discount structure is contingent on PC9x compliance - if you haven't looked at these standards lately, it's an eye-opener to see what MS is dictating to the PC OEMs. They will not hesitate to use this power to make life very difficult for Linux or any other challenger.
San did a great job on the NetWinder BIOS kernel - I wish him well at VA - we are all saddened by the demise of CCC, but it will be interesting to see if his Linux kernel boot monitor/BIOS can make the transition into the x86 world.
"The future's good and the present is nothing to sneeze at." - Roblimo's last
Dude, the last I heard, MCI was still based out of Cedar Rapids, IA. That's where it was born and blossomed. I didn't think they would move it. If so, I will stand corrected. I lived in CR, IA for a while, there's a lot of telemarketing and telecom in amongst the corn.
--Somewhere there is a village missing an idiot.
Cool idea, but from the standpoint of somebody who needs his machines to be up 24-7, I want standard, off-the-shelf hardware inside my server's case. I want to be able to replace any and all hardware within a couple of hours. The more VA Research deviates from standard PC hardware, the more they resemble Sun, SGI, and the rest of the commercial UNIX vendors.
I must have been chatting to him on IRC on and
off for a year or two. It only clicked once I
saw the COMDEX reports on NetWinder who he was.
I still have yet to see Linux actually running on
StrongARM. I believe it's quite smart.
Bruce M. Simpson Unix/Network Bod & Win32 Developer
Sheesh, San, have a little modesty!
-russ
p.s. I *still* owe San lunch.
Don't piss off The Angry Economist
1) VA may be thinking of coming out with a competitor to the Cobalt Qube. Think Netwinder except perhaps Intel-powered (considering VA's connections with Intel).
Unless something has radically changed, the Netwinders are Intel based, running on the StrongArm chip, which Intel got as part of its massive settlement with Digital before Digital was bought by Compaq.
and whats he doing for VA?
;)
VA---the Compaq of Linux
Redhat---The Microsoft of Linux
now all we need is a chip parallel...
Gee, Chris, you're quick to dismiss things without any thought. That seems to be a real problem for you Mac guys- you just can't think outside the box. Yes, you can paint that box all kinds of colors and call it "innovation" but it's still a box that 97% of the market doesn't want.
Right now the venerable PC platform is at a turning point. The BIOS that provides complete compatibility with earlier machines and software is becoming less and less necessary. SGI already has taken the lead by incoroprating their ARC NVRAM into a line of Intel NT boxes. If you're a "real" Linux user (not you, Chris), the kind who makes new kernels regularly, you've dreamed of being able to start your PC in protected mode, and just load a 5MB kernel right into flat memory right off of your new 100GB disk with no drama. So why not do it? There's nothing holding us back technically. The need is finally there on a large enough scale to make it profitable to do. Let's do it!
Chris, you're going to have to face the fact that there's nothing special about your Mac. Integrating OS functionality into firmware isn't the sole province of the Apple clergy, for them to dole out jealously. It's just another place to put software, and there's no magic about it. You should get "outside" more, heh heh.
Mr. Natural -- Cat Herder
Sorry, Chris. I saw the Evangelist title, and coupled with what appeared to be more knee-jerk pooh-poohing of a PC's abilities, I bit. I guess I've faced enough subscribers to the evangelist that the snappy comebacks are hard to stop! I am offended by people who on one hand want to be as cool as Linux, but on the other think of things like like compiling a custom kernel a Bad Thing.
Thanks for taking it in good humor. I did rest well that night!
Mr. Natural -- Cat Herder
I myself live in richmond va. i used to think this place was madd boring and had nothing more than a bunch of hicks but it has really grownup technologically.
--------------- -=/[sóú£f£ÿ]\=- ---------------
Yup, we all hung out last night. I have to say he's one of the most intelligent and gifted computer people I know. I can't even begin to expand. The guy is incredibly on the edge of technology all the time, and never ceases to amaze me in his technical abilities -- and we've known him almost 10 years.